Vegan Banana Cream Pie Recipe

Ingredients
For the Pie Crust:
- 1 ½ cups graham cracker crumbs: The base of your pie crust; use vegan-friendly graham crackers or a gluten-free alternative if needed.
- 1/4 cup coconut oil (melted): Provides richness and helps bind the crust.
- 2 tablespoons maple syrup: Adds sweetness; can be replaced with agave syrup if desired.
- 1/4 teaspoon salt: Enhances the flavor of the crust.
For the Banana Cream Filling:
- 1 ½ cups unsweetened almond milk: The liquid base of the filling; can be substituted with any plant-based milk.
- 1/4 cup cornstarch: Acts as a thickening agent for the custard filling.
- 1/3 cup maple syrup: Sweetens the filling; adjust to taste.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: Enhances the flavor.
- 1/4 teaspoon turmeric: Adds a touch of color; optional.
- 2 medium ripe bananas: Sliced, for layering and flavor.
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ice: Prevents bananas from browning and adds freshness.
For Topping:
- 1 cup coconut cream (chilled): The base for whipped topping; can also use store-bought vegan whipped cream.
- 1 tablespoon powdered sugar: Sweetens the topping.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: For flavor.
- Additional banana slices and chocolate shavings (optional): For garnish.
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Pie Crust
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Preheating ensures even baking of the crust.
- Mix Crust Ingredients: In a medium b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s, melted coconut oil, maple syrup, and salt. Mix until the crumbs are evenly coated and resemble wet sand.
- Form the Crust: Press the mixture firmly into the bottom and up the sides of a 9-inch pie pan. Use the back of a measuring cup or your fingers to create an even layer.
- Bake the Crust: Bake the crust in the preheated oven for 8-10 minutes until lightly golden. Remove from the oven and let it cool completely while you prepare the filling.
Step 2: Make the Banana Cream Filling
- Whisk the Dry Ingredients: In a saucepan, combine the cornstarch, turmeric (if using), and a pinch of salt. Whisk together to eliminate lumps.
- Add the Almond Milk: Gradually pour in the almond milk while whisking continuously to ensure a smooth mixture. This step is crucial for preventing lumps from forming in the custard.
- Sweeten the Mixture: Add the maple syrup and vanilla extract to the saucepan, stirring well to combine all the ingredients.
- Cook the Filling: Place the saucepan over medium heat. Stir constantly until the mixture thickens and begins to bubble. This should take about 5-7 minutes. Once thickened, remove from heat.
- Incorporate Lemon Juice: Stir in the lemon juice for a touch of brightness. Allow the filling to cool for a few minutes before layering it in the pie.
Step 3: Assemble the Pie
- Layer the Bananas: Arrange half of the banana slices in the bottom of the cooled pie crust. This will provide a flavorful layer beneath the filling.
- Add the Custard Filling: Pour the thickened banana cream filling over the banana slices, smoothing the top with a spatula.
- Top with Remaining Bananas: Gently arrange the remaining banana slices on top of the custard filling, pressing them in slightly.
Step 4: Prepare the Whipped Topping
- Chill the Coconut Cream: Ensure your coconut cream has been chilled in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ours or overnight. This helps it whip up nicely.
- Whip the Coconut Cream: In a mixing bowl, scoop out the solid part of the chilled coconut cream, leaving the liquid behind. Add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ract. Using an electric mixer, beat the coconut cream until fluffy and smooth.
Step 5: Top and Chill the Pie
- Spread the Whipped Topping: Carefully spread the whipped coconut cream over the banana layer, smoothing it out with a spatula or the back of a spoon.
- Garnish: If desired, garnish the pie with additional banana slices and chocolate shavings for a decorative touch.
- Chill the Pie: Place the pie in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ours to allow the flavors to meld and the filling to set. This step is crucial for achieving the perfect texture.
Step 6: Serve the Pie
- Slice and Serve: Once chilled, remove the pie from the refrigerator. Slice into wedges and serve chilled. Enjoy the delightful combination of creamy filling, sweet bananas, and a crunchy crust!
Step 7: Store Leftovers
- Store Leftovers: Any leftover pie can be covered with plastic wrap or st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The bananas may brown slightly, but the flavor will still be delicious.
Nutritional Information (per slice, serves 10)
- Calories: 210
- Total Fat: 12g
- Saturated Fat: 10g
- Cholesterol: 0mg
- Sodium: 75mg
- Total Carbohydrates: 25g
- Dietary Fiber: 2g
- Net Carbohydrates: 23g
- Protein: 2g
- SmartPoints (WW): 6
Tips for Success
- Choosing Bananas: Use ripe bananas for the best flavor and sweetness. Look for bananas with a few brown spots for optimal ripeness.
- Prevent Browning: To keep the banana slices fresh, you can brush them lightly with lemon juice after cutting.
- Customize Your Topping: Feel free to get creative with toppings! Chopped nuts, toasted coconut, or even a drizzle of chocolate sauce can elevate your pie.
